With a TT107-36-IRV PowerGuard™️ filter element in hand, the maintenance professionals were ready to conduct their testing to ensure TTI’s filter element met their expectations. Their method included using a portable oil analysis machine installed on a vacuum dehydrator to report ISO fluid cleanliness codes and other data points such as viscosity, temperature, and moisture. The maintenance team selected two identical, equally contaminated systems for head-to-head evaluation on the same maintenance schedule. First, they installed a new competitor filter element into their vacuum dehydrator. They ran it until they removed the necessary amount of dissolved water, monitoring particle counts during the process and live printing test results as reported. The next day, the maintenance team drained the vacuum dehydrator and installed the TTI filter element. The machine was then moved to the next system, repeating the same procedure the day prior.

Testing showed that the competitor filter element had cleaned the oil to an ISO cleanliness code of 20/15/09. In contrast, TTI’s filter element in the same time frame resulted in an ISO code of 12/05/00. This difference is an improvement of 99.5% or better in particulate capture in the 4µm, 6µm, and 14µm ISO cleanliness codes than the competitors filter element. These results distinguish the media technologies used in both filter elements. TTI’s Dual Phase Microglass media has a built-in pre-filter layer that reduces pressure drop while increasing dirt-holding capacity without compromising efficiency.
